Gynecological cancer rehabilitation supports recovery after cancers of the uterus, cervix, ovaries, and related structures. Treatments often cause pelvic floor weakness, lymphedema, pain, fatigue, and emotional distress. Physiotherapy restores mobility, strengthens core and pelvic floor, reduces swelling, and improves bladder, bowel, and sexual function. Evidence-based rehab enhances recovery, quality of life, and confidence throughout survivorship.
Causes of Impairments Post-Treatment:
- Surgery (hysterectomy, oophorectomy, lymph node removal)
- Radiation-induced fibrosis and pelvic stiffness
- Chemotherapy-related weakness and fatigue
- Hormonal changes affecting tissues
- Lymphedema in legs or pelvis
- Scar adhesions and postural changes
Symptoms:
- Pelvic floor weakness and urinary leakage
- Pain or stiffness in pelvic and abdominal region
- Swelling in legs or pelvic area (lymphedema)
- Fatigue and reduced endurance
- Pain during intimacy (dyspareunia)
- Emotional distress and reduced quality of life
